IIRC you need to lock the parent table in one session and then do whatever 
you need to do to the mlog table in a SECOND session (because, as another 
poster pointed out, the lock will be released too soon otherwise).

> I do it all the time. Actually you don't have to lock the 
> table; you may
> simply quiesce the table, meaning no transations will be allowed.
> 
> Steps:
> 
> Quiesce the table
> Apply all the pending logs in the deferred trans queue on 
> secondary database
> Truncate The MLOG$ table.
> 
> No issues; in fact I think (note sure) it is supported by 
> Oracle. And it
> should be; MLOG$ tables are just plain simple tables anyway.
